Web29 sep. 2024 · A lithium test measures the concentration of the drug in a sample of blood. Measurements are reported in millimoles per liter (mmol/L). As a medication, lithium is usually taken by mouth. It is absorbed by the gastrointestinal system and enters the blood, allowing the blood concentration to be measured. Web31 mei 2016 · After starting lithium, it takes about five days for the lithium to build up to a steady level in the blood. For this reason your doctor will take a blood sample to check …
